Which of the following is a barrier to effective communication?

A. using excessive amounts of jargon

B. communicating while physical distractions are present

C. using an incorrect communication channel

<u>D. all of the above</u>

What does the term lockout/ragout refer to?
enyata [817]
<span>Lockout-tagout (LOTO) or lock and tag is a safety procedure which is used in industry and research settings to ensure that dangerous machines are properly shut off and not able to be started up again prior to the completion of maintenance or servicing work.</span>

Beta-lactam antibacterial drugs, such as penicillins and cephalosporins, combat infection by binding to proteins in bacterial ce
zhannawk [14.2K]

The binding of Beta-lactam antibacterial drugs to proteins in cell membranes cause <u>bacterial lysis and cell death.</u>

<u></u>

β-Lactam antibiotics inhibit bacteria by binding covalently to PBPs in the cytoplasmic membrane. These target proteins catalyze the synthesis of the peptidoglycan that forms the cell wall of bacteria.

β-lactam antibiotics are bactericidal, and act by inhibiting the synthesis of the peptidoglycan layer of bacterial cell walls. The peptidoglycan layer is important for cell wall structural integrity, especially in Gram-positive organisms.

The peptidoglycan layer being the outermost and primary component of the wall. Alterations of PBPs can lead to β-lactam antibiotic resistance.
